Case Studies

An established anesthesiology group acquired 3 additional ASCs from a departing anesthesiology group, and needed immediate short term staffing to fulfil new contractual obligations. UAC was contracted to staff for 1 year to allow the group to retain the new contracted sites while they aggressively recruit anesthesiologists. UAC were already credentialed with this client at a few facilities and the staffing at this site was seamless as it allowed the group’s leadership and other anesthesiologists to rotate through the new facilities and establish themselves.

Hospital contacted UAC due to unsuccessful negotiations with the contracted anesthesiology group to increase points of service. Current anesthesiology group unable to provide additional points of services due to labor shortage and inability to hire. UAC provided the remaining points of service on agreed upon terms while working with the existing anesthesiology group as well as administration.

A busy ASC contacted UAC for maternal leave coverage for their employed anesthesia chairman and medical director. UAC provided a physician everyday for 3 months to provide coverage and continued PRN coverage for the anesthesiologist.

BILLING

We do not bill patients directly. We negotiate a fair labor charge per day with the anesthesia group while allowing the anesthesia groups to retain full control of billing and continue established relationships with their contracted surgeons and/or hospitals. Our role as anesthesiology consultants is to fill staffing needs and shortages.
